qeh5mmalww是一款全能的编程开发工具,可以帮助开发者完成从需求分析、设计到开发的全流程。以下从多个方面详细介绍如何使用qeh5mmalww进行全能编程开发。
一、环境配置
首先,需要对环境进行配置。以下是qeh5mmalww所需环境以及相关配置步骤:
环境要求: - Windows / Linux / Mac - JDK 8 或以上版本 - Maven 3.3 或以上版本 - Node.js 6.0 或以上版本 配置步骤: 1. 安装JDK,配置JAVA_HOME环境变量 2. 安装Maven,配置MAVEN_HOME环境变量 3. 安装Node.js
配置完成后,即可进行下一步操作。
二、项目创建
使用qeh5mmalww创建项目非常简单,以下是具体步骤:
- 在终端中输入以下命令创建项目:
- 等待项目创建完成后,进入项目目录
- 运行以下命令启动项目
mvn archetype:generate -DarchetypeGroupId=org.qeh5 -DarchetypeArtifactId=qeh5mmalww-archetype -DarchetypeVersion=1.0.0 -DgroupId=com.example -DartifactId=myproject -Dversion=1.0.0-SNAPSHOT -Dpackaging=jar
cd myproject
mvn spring-boot:run
三、代码开发
qeh5mmalww提供了全能编程开发的能力,同时支持多种编程语言,以下是qeh5mmalww的代码示例:
package com.example.demo; import org.springframework.web.bind.annotation.RequestMapping; import org.springframework.web.bind.annotation.RestController; @RestController public class HelloWorldController { @RequestMapping("/hello") public String sayHello() { return "Hello World!"; } }
以上是一个简单的Spring Boot应用程序,使用@RestController注解将该类标记为RESTful Web服务控制器。@RequestMapping注解告诉Spring MVC将该方法映射到“/hello”网址上。
四、测试与调试
在开发过程中,测试与调试是必不可少的环节,qeh5mmalww也提供了丰富的测试与调试功能。以下是qeh5mmalww的测试示例:
package com.example.demo; import org.junit.Test; import static org.junit.Assert.assertEquals; public class HelloWorldControllerTest { @Test public void testSayHello() { HelloWorldController helloWorldController = new HelloWorldController(); String result = helloWorldController.sayHello(); assertEquals("Hello World!", result); } }
以上是一个简单的测试用例,使用JUnit测试框架对HelloWorldController进行测试。在实际开发中,还可以使用更多的测试工具和框架进行测试与调试。
五、部署与发布
在项目开发完成后,需要将项目部署到服务器上。以下是qeh5mmalww的部署与发布示例:
- 使用以下命令打包项目
- 将生成的jar文件部署到服务器上
- 运行以下命令启动项目
mvn package
scp target/myproject-1.0.0-SNAPSHOT.jar user@server:/path/to/destination
java -jar /path/to/destination/myproject-1.0.0-SNAPSHOT.jar
六、总结
以上就是使用qeh5mmalww进行全能编程开发的最佳实践。通过详细的环境配置、项目创建、代码开发、测试与调试、部署与发布等步骤,可以快速、高效地完成从需求分析到开发的全流程。